Ken Davy: Altmann must curb people's freedom
Pensions minister needs to act quickly on insistent clients.
I have long been an advocate of Baroness (Ros) Altmann and, in particular, the sterling work she has undertaken over many years on behalf of consumers.
From her campaign to raise awareness about the bleak situation of the Allied Steel and Wire workers, to her unfailing support of the plight of Equitable Life policyholders, her opinions are almost always well-reasoned, fair and just, while equally importantly, she has offered practical support rather than mere rhetoric.
While Baroness Altmann’s recent appointment to the position of pensions minister caused some to fear her independence might become victim of a political agenda, so far, any such concerns have proved groundless and it is good to see that the rights of the consumer have remained firmly at the top of her agenda.
